Output 1c84f0ba62a9831a2a1c0ee83b27868ea703dca89d1c077c81fd8628000cf473:1

value
50732859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9515cc6188feb3bcccf02d2fb8dfd7e4886d0457 OP_EQUAL
address
3FHJihkDYGeg7orTZnrR71oCcSmPvjkKuz
transaction
1c84f0ba62a9831a2a1c0ee83b27868ea703dca89d1c077c81fd8628000cf473
spent
true